Evolution of Camera Lenses and AI Integration

Over the past decade, camera lens technology has steadily advanced, with manufacturers focusing on improving optical performance, compactness, and user interface. The recent integration of artificial intelligence into camera systems has primarily been limited to software, such as scene recognition and auto-settings. The 2026 launch of AI-optimized lenses marks a significant shift, embedding intelligent algorithms directly into the lens hardware. This follows earlier prototypes and research from companies like Sony, Canon, and Nikon, who have demonstrated AI-assisted autofocus and image processing in their camera bodies. The new lenses are expected to leverage these capabilities to deliver real-time adjustments, reducing the need for manual intervention and post-processing.

Key Questions

What are AI-optimized camera lenses?

AI-optimized camera lenses are lenses equipped with embedded artificial intelligence algorithms that automatically adjust focus, exposure, and other settings in real-time to improve image quality and user experience.

Which brands are releasing AI-enhanced lenses in 2026?

Major manufacturers such as Sony, Canon, and Nikon have announced plans to release AI-optimized lenses throughout 2026, with the first models expected in the middle of the year.

How will AI features improve my photography?

AI features can enhance autofocus speed and accuracy, optimize exposure in complex lighting, and adapt to different scenes automatically, making photography easier and more reliable for users of all skill levels.

Are these lenses compatible with existing camera bodies?

Compatibility depends on the brand and model. Most new AI lenses are designed for specific mounts like Sony E-mount, Canon RF, or Nikon Z, but some may require adapters for older camera bodies. Details will be clarified upon official release.

Will AI-optimized lenses be affordable for amateurs?

Pricing details are not yet confirmed, but early indications suggest that AI features may initially be available on higher-end models. However, as technology matures, more affordable options are expected to emerge.
